GetSaveAsFileName, cant find project or library

Status
Niet open voor verdere reacties.

dandiep

Gebruiker
Lid geworden
18 apr 2016
Berichten
27
Goedenavond,

Ik zit alweer enige tijd te stoeien met het volgende.

Ik prober vanuit een functie een .xlsm op te slaan, maar krijg de code niet gecompileerd.
Het compileren struikeld ieder keer over .GetSaveAsFileName met als foutmeling: cant find project or library.

Al struinend over het almachtige www kom ik maar tot één conclusie, de referentie in de VBA editor klopt niet.
Het probleem is echter dat ik niet kan achterhalen welke library aan/uit moet staan.

In de bijlage mijn instellingen.

Weet iemand aan welke library GetSaveAsFileName gerelateerd is?

Gr.
Danny
 
Goedenavond,

Het probleem is echter opgelost mbv een andere code.

Code:
Set oExcel = CreateObject("Excel.Application")
Set oExcelWrkBk = oExcel.Workbooks.Open("D:\EmptyTemplate.xlsm")
...
...
..
oExcel.ScreenUpdating = True
oExcel.Visible = True
oExcel.Application.DisplayAlerts = False

oExcelWrkBk.SaveAs fileName

Excel zichtbaar maken voor afsluiten:

Daarna netjes excel afsluiten

    oExcel.Application.DisplayAlerts = False
    oExcel.Workbooks.Close
    oExcel.Quit
    Set oExcelWrSht = Nothing
    Set oExcelWrkBk = Nothing
    Set oExcel = Nothing

Het netjes afsluiten had wat voeten in aarde, maar werkt inmiddels ook goed.
Case closed.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an